DEFINITION: NIDS (Network Intrusion Detection System)

NIDS or Network Intrusion Detection System are solutions that analyze traffic and try to find unusual activities, like scanning, intrusion attempts, lateral movements, exfiltration, backdoors, command and control, etc. This was initially done through signatures, but over time some solutions evolved to NTA.
